ACTION RATIFICATION OF Agenda Item K-1 PERSONNEL ACTIONS June 23, 2006 Background KRS 164.365 gives governing boards exclusive control of employment, tenure, and official relations of employees. Rationale On March 19, 1998, the Board of Regents delegated to the KCTCS President the authority to administer personnel actions, with such actions to be presented to the Board for review and ratification at each regularly scheduled Board meeting. Recommendation That the KCTCS Board of Regents ratify the personnel actions listed in the agenda materials. 121
